Investing.com – Finland stocks were higher after the close on Wednesday, as gains in the Basic Materials, Consumer Services and Financials sectors led shares higher.
At the close in Helsinki, the OMX Helsinki 25 gained 1.33%.
The best performers of the session on the OMX Helsinki 25 were Stora Enso Oyj R (HE:STERV), which rose 3.45% or 0.315 points to trade at 9.435 at the close. Meanwhile, Amer Sports Corporation (HE:AMEAS) added 2.56% or 0.67 points to end at 26.85 and Konecranes Oyj (HE:KCR1V) was up 2.35% or 0.60 points to 26.10 in late trade.
The worst performers of the session were Fortum Oyj (HE:FUM1V), which fell 1.24% or 0.17 points to trade at 13.51 at the close. Outokumpu Oyj (HE:OUT1V) declined 0.40% or 0.0120 points to end at 2.9580 and Kemira Oyj (HE:KRA1V) was down 0.09% or 0.01 points to 11.05.
Rising stocks outnumbered declining ones on the Helsinki Stock Exchange by 113 to 72.
Shares in Amer Sports Corporation (HE:AMEAS) rose to all time highs; rising 2.56% or 0.67 to 26.85.
Brent oil for January delivery was down 2.66% or 1.28 to $46.82 a barrel. Elsewhere in commodities trading, Crude oil for delivery in December fell 2.56% or 1.13 to hit $43.08 a barrel, while the December Gold contract fell 0.22% or 2.40 to trade at $1086.10 a troy ounce.
EUR/USD was up 0.09% to 1.0734, while EUR/GBP fell 0.47% to 0.7061.
The US Dollar Index was down 0.15% at 99.12.
